The "Cheats by Tech Tips.7z" file is typically a compressed archive containing a database of cheat codes and engine modifications for retro gaming emulators, most notably MAME (Multiple Arcade Machine Emulator). This file allows users to unlock hidden features, infinite lives, or level selects in thousands of classic arcade games. Key Features of the Cheat Collection
Universal Compatibility: The .7z format is a high-compression archive that can be opened by tools like 7-Zip or WinRAR. Once extracted, the cheat.dat or cheat.xml file is recognized by almost all modern versions of MAME.
Automated Game Detection: When properly integrated, the emulator automatically scans the database and displays available cheats specific to the game currently being played, eliminating the need to manually enter hex codes.
Extensive Database: These collections often include codes for over 10,000 arcade titles, ranging from classics like Pac-Man and Street Fighter to obscure regional releases.
In-Game Menu Integration: Most emulators provide a real-time overlay. By enabling the "Cheat" plugin in your general settings, you can toggle cheats on or off while the game is running without restarting. How to Install and Enable Cheats
To use the contents of a cheats.7z file in an emulator like MAME, follow these steps:
Placement: Move the cheat.7z file into the main folder where your emulator (e.g., mame.exe) is located. You often do not need to unzip it, as MAME can read the .7z file directly. Configuration: Open your mame.ini or plugin.ini file in a text editor.
Find the line that says cheat and change the value from 0 to 1. Activation: Launch MAME and go to General Settings > Plugins. Ensure the Cheat plugin is set to "On".
Once in a game, press the Tab key to open the menu and select "Cheats" to see your options. GTA San Andreas Cheat Codes Guide | PDF | History - Scribd

Searching for specific files like "cheats by tech tips.7z" often leads to community-uploaded archives used for emulators or game mods. While a single "official" version may not exist, these types of .7z files typically contain cheat databases (
) for flashcarts (like R4 cards) or cheat tables for software like Cheat Engine. ⚠️ Safety Warning
Downloading .7z or .zip archives from third-party sites carries significant risks, including malware or viruses that can compromise your device. Always scan such files with reputable antivirus software or VirusTotal before opening them. Never disable your antivirus to run a cheat file. How to Use "cheats by tech tips.7z"
If you have downloaded this file for a flashcart or emulator, follow these general steps to set it up: Extract the Archive: If you’ve spent any time in tech forums,
Since it is a .7z file, you will need a tool like 7-Zip or WinRAR. Right-click the file and select Extract Here. Identify the Contents: usrcheat.dat: Used for Nintendo DS flashcarts. .ct files: Cheat tables for Cheat Engine.
.txt or .cht files: Often used for emulators like RetroArch or DuckStation. Installation Guide (by device): For Flashcarts (R4/NDS): Locate the usrcheat.dat file inside the extracted folder. Connect your SD card to your PC.
Copy the file to the __aio/cheats/ or _nds/ folder (depending on your firmware).
In your flashcart menu, select a game and press the Cheats button (usually Y or X) to enable them. For PC (Cheat Engine): Open the game you want to cheat in. Run Cheat Engine as administrator.
Click the Folder icon to load the .ct file from your extracted folder.
Select the game process (the computer icon) and check the boxes for the cheats you want to activate. For Emulators (RetroArch/PCSX2):
RetroArch: You can often use the Online Updater to "Update Cheats" directly rather than downloading external files.
PCSX2: Move .pnach or .txt files to the cheats folder in your emulator directory, then enable cheats in the System or Properties menu. Looking for specific game codes?

Understanding the Risks of "Cheats By Tech Tips"
The ".7z" extension indicates a compressed file created with 7-Zip. While the 7-Zip software itself is legitimate and open-source, the files contained within these specific third-party archives may not be.
Potential for Malware: Many "cheat" downloads are "stealer" type malware designed to compromise your personal data, including passwords and bank accounts.
Fake Installers: There have been documented cases where websites mimicking official tool sites (like 7zip.com instead of the official 7-zip.org) distribute Trojans that grant hackers full system access.
Ransomware Scams: Some archives claiming to be game source code or advanced mods, such as "gtasa.7z", have been flagged as ransomware that locks your computer until a payment is made. Safe Alternatives for Game Cheats
